Handball Bundesliga (women) 1992/93

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

The 1992/93 season of the women's handball league is the eighth in its history. 14 teams played for the German championship. TV Lützellinden became the champion .

German champion: TV Lützellinden .
DHB Cup winner: TuS Walle Bremen .
Relegated to the 2nd Bundesliga: DJK Schwarz-Weiß Wiesbaden , VfL Oldenburg and PSV Grünweiß Frankfurt .
Newcomers from the 2nd Bundesliga: Borussia Dortmund , TSG Wismar and DJK Würzburg .
